Most desired consumer items of 2020 include the new Xbox and PlayStation but this may be the last ‘console war’ between Microsoft and Sony – ABC News
Subscription-based digital platforms — allowing gamers to play against each other on PCs, mobiles and tablets — may dim the future of the devices.

This Christmas many Australians will be dreaming of ripping wrapping paper off the most desired consumer items of 2020: gaming consoles from Microsoft and Sony.
Key points:
- New gaming consoles from Microsoft (Xbox) and Sony (PS5) have just been released
- This might be the last iteration of the two-decade-long ‘console wars’ between the companies
- Digital platforms, allowing gamers to play on PCs, tablets and mobiles, might spell the end of consoles
